Role
At Hive Robotics, we are developing secure networking technologies for next-generation unmanned platforms and RF communication systems. Our focus is on high-performance, low-latency based mesh networking over software-defined radios, designed to operate reliably in dynamic and highly crowded environments.
As a Mesh Network Engineer, you will design, implement, and optimize the low-level mesh networking stack, with a strong emphasis on Layer 2 and below. Your work will enable reliable, encrypted IP communication across mobile ad-hoc networks (MANETs) under challenging RF conditions.
Responsibilities
  • Design, develop, andmaintainlow-level embeddedmesh networking stackfor wireless, decentralized, and mobile ad-hoc systems.
  • Designand implement a custom mesh layer atLayer 2or belowto minimize IP packet latency in high-interference and jammed environments.
  • Optimizemesh networking for bandwidth efficiency, latency, fast convergence, and resilience in rapidly changing topologies.
  • Build tight integration between the IP stack and the underlying mesh layer, enabling intelligent packet handling, prioritization, and recovery.
  • Integrate cryptographic, encryption, and key management mechanisms into embedded communication pipelines.
  • Collaborate closely with SDR, RF, hardware, and systems teams to align networking software with radio architectures and waveform constraints.
  • Support system-level testing, validation, and performance analysis in simulation, lab, and field environments.
  • Participate in defining communication architectures, including routing strategies, quality of service (QoS), time-of-flight, synchronization, and network resilience.
  • Contribute to design documentation, system integration, and continuous improvement of communication frameworks.
Requirements
  • Master’s degree in Computer Science, Communications Engineering, ora relatedfield.
  • 7+ years of proven experience with wireless networking and mobile ad-hoc networks (MANETs).
  • Strong understanding of MAC (Layer 2), Network (Layer 3), and Transport (Layer 4) protocols, including TCP/IP, UDP, routing, and congestion control.
  • Solid background in embedded Linux networking, including the Linux IP stack; strong proficiency in C/C++.
  • Demonstrated ability to design or modify low-level networking layers to meet strict latency and reliability constraints.
  • Experience with cryptography, encryption, and key management for embedded or wireless communication systems.
  • Familiarity with Linux-based embedded platforms, real-time operating systems (RTOS), and network stacks.
  • Ability to work independently, take technical ownership, and collaborate effectively across disciplines.
  • Excellent communication skills in English; German is a plus.
  • Based in Munich or willing to relocate.
  • ExperiencedevelopingLinux kernel space, particularly networkingsubsystemsor drivers.
  • Knowledge of secure communication frameworks such as TLS, DTLS, IPsec, or custom lightweight protocols.
  • Familiarity with routing approaches for dynamic mesh networks (e.g., OLSR, BATMAN, AODV, DSR).
  • Hands-on experience with network simulation and analysis tools (ns-3,OMNeT++,Scapy).
  • Background in cybersecurity, resilient communications, or interference-aware system design.
  • Strong practical interest in SDRs, RF systems, wireless communications, or distributed robotic platforms.
